Descriptions of our three (3) organizations:

1. VOTERPUNCH

VoterPunch is an educational tool, which enhances participation in the increasingly vital arena of internet activism by informing and inspiring Americans to fulfill their responsibilities as citizens. Designed as a nonpartisan voting record service, VoterPunch makes it easy for individuals to both learn about what is happening on Capitol Hill and to interact with their elected officials, whether to praise, chide, or demand support before a vote happens on the floor of Congress.

Presently, VoterPunch can be seen in action powering the informative website www.ProgressivePunch.org which serves as a demonstration site for VoterPunch. ProgressivePunch.org displays highly detailed, up to the moment, expert analysis of all important votes that are taken in Congress. ProgressivePunch.org uses a ranking system so that people can see how progressively their representative scores within the spectrum of overall voting records, in the 14 master categories and 140 subcategories created by VoterPunch. Additionally, the site features ultra-easily accessible info from VoterPunch displaying how members of Congress voted on a vote by vote basis. Detailed vote descriptions are original content, written for VoterPunch by Congressional scholars. VoterPunch is a non-profit organization (we're currently in the process of applying for 501(c)(3) status), seeking and able to accept tax deductible contributions to further expand our capabilities.

2. PROGRESSIVEKICK

ProgressiveKick is a 527 organization--not a PAC-- that allows people to donate money OR services towards educating voters in the country's states and districts where progressive candidates are running for Congressional office. ProgressiveKick analyzes races, with cutting edge technology, to determine where progressive candidates have a viable chance to win seats across the country. ProgressiveKick will use its donations to educate the voters of the targeted states and districts about the voting records and affiliations of the candidates in a clear, concise and factual manner. As a 527 organization, ProgressiveKick can accept donations without limitation. Donations are not tax-deductible.

3. PROGRESSIVEPUNCH.ORG

ProgressivePunch.Org is a for-profit DBA (Doing Business As) sole proprietorship, founded by Joshua Grossman. ProgressivePunch.Org not only provides an online demonstration site for the VoterPunch database, but also licenses key elements for the functioning of its database of Congressional voting records, to VoterPunch. These elements were designed by Joshua Grossman and include (a) the algorithm which identifies ideologically polarized votes cast in Congress which should be included in the database, (b) the taxonomy or vote classification system for the votes, and (c) the software that spiders into Congress's website in order to obtain the voting record data.
